Three reasons to keep your garage door in good condition

Blog

Many homeowners pay very little attention to the condition of their garage doors. However, there are several important reasons why you should have this item regularly serviced, and repaired by a garage door repairs specialist when necessary. Read on to find out what these reasons are.

To reduce the risk of a burglary

If your garage door is damaged in some way or has deteriorated as a result of a lack of regular maintenance, it could be very easy for a burglar to break it open and gain access to all of the valuable goods you store inside your garage.

For example, if the metal hinges on the door are damaged by corrosion, a reasonably-strong thief could pry the door off these weakened hinges with a crowbar in a matter of minutes.

As such, if you routinely use your garage to store valuable items (such as a vehicle, sports equipment or gardening tools), then it's vital to have any damaged or deteriorated sections of its door repaired promptly.

To prevent the items you store inside the garage from being damaged

If you store any items in your garage that could be damaged by moisture, it is essential to keep the door to this space in excellent condition.

If a garage door develops a hole as a result of wet rot (in wooden doors) or corrosion (in metal doors), it could lead to rainwater seeping into the garage. This, in turn, could lead to any clothing, paperwork or other delicate items that are housed inside this area ending up destroyed by moisture and mould.

Given this, should you spot any gaps (however small) in your garage door, you should contact a garage door repairs specialist immediately.

To maintain the value of your home

The garage is usually a highly visible structure; as such, its condition can affect the overall appearance of a property's exterior. This, in turn, can have an impact on the property's value as a whole.

If your garage door is severely corroded or is covered in peeling, discoloured paint, then it could make your home exterior look dilapidated and neglected, and in doing so, could reduce the property's 'kerb appeal' (that is, how attractive and appealing your home looks from the outside).

As such, if you are considering putting your property on the market at some point, it's sensible to maintain your garage door. Use oil to lubricate and protect its metal components (such as its springs, hinges and locks) and have any visible damage repaired promptly. Additionally, you should have it repainted or re-varnished at least once a year.
